### Runbook: ReminderWren nightly job

ReminderWren sends next-day appointment reminders for the Ashgrove clinic network. It runs at 02:00 local, pulls the schedule snapshot, and dispatches messages in batches of 200. Before each release, confirm the batch window setting matches production, verify the dry-run flag is off, and check that the dead-letter queue is empty from the prior run. The job authenticates to the Pimbleton messaging gateway at startup, and the credential it presents is set on the line immediately below.

sealed setting: RELAY_SECRET5=82864

// WaveGlance preview module.
// These constants control downsampling and render caps for the
// waveform strip shown in the Tonelark upload screen. Changing them
// affects every cached preview, so bump the cache version too.
// Don't tune by eye; run the bench suite first.
// The current values are defined here.

constants for tageg-kagag:
QUOTAS = {
    "kelax": 495,
    "istath": 366,
    "tammir": 108,
    "novdor": 730,
    "casax": 816,
    "quenael": 874,
    "pelius": 403,
}

Handover — catalog cache invalidation (from Deryn to whoever's next)

The Lumenshop catalog cache invalidates on product-update events, not TTL alone; the TTL is just a safety net. If stale prices appear, check the event consumer lag first. Everything runs off one config map, reproduced here in full so you can sanity-check it.

deployment values, yadug-bawif:
[framir]
team = pelox
access_code = ac_a38ab2
owner = tamion.julael
host = framir.tolvaqlabs.test
port = 11211
peer = tammir.zemvargrid.local
salt = 2215ef03
pin = 1541

- [ ] **Step 7: Breaker override escrow.** After sealing the signing keys for the Tallgrove upstream API circuit breaker, confirm the support team can force the breaker open during a full outage. The override bundle lives in the sealed escrow drawer and is useless without its unlock phrase. Two ceremony witnesses must initial this step before proceeding. The escrow bundle is decrypted with the recovery passphrase that follows.

vault phrase of kahip-kahop = holath-quenmir